What is a Bay Window?
Bay windows normally include three sections-- a big central window flanked by 2 smaller sized side windows-- projecting outside from the main walls. This design creates a small nook within the home, perfect for seating, plants, or decorative display screens.

Estimating Costs of Bay Window Installation
The cost of setting up a bay window can vary extensively based upon a number of elements. Here are key parts that affect installation quotes:
Factor | Description |
---|---|
Window Material | Expenses differ depending upon whether windows are vinyl, wood, or fiberglass. |
Size and Design | Larger and custom-designed windows will normally increase the overall cost. |
Installation Complexity | More complicated installations (e.g., structural changes or difficult gain access to) need more labor and materials. |
Place | The regional cost of labor and products can impact installation quotes. |
Pre-existing Structures | Costs might increase if there are old windows or structural issues that need dealing with prior to installation. |
Average Cost Ranges
A general understanding of prospective costs can help homeowners spending plan efficiently. Bay window installation rates can vary from ₤ 1,000 to ₤ 5,000, depending upon the aspects laid out above. Higher-end materials and custom designs can see prices surpassing this variety, specifically in major cities.
Breakdown of Installation Costs
Here's a more in-depth breakdown of what expenses may include in a bay window installation quote:
Cost Component | Approximated Cost |
---|---|
Windows (material) | ₤ 300 - ₤ 1,500 each |
Installation labor | ₤ 100 - ₤ 250 per hour |
Structural support | ₤ 500 - ₤ 2,000 (if needed) |
Finishing work (interior/exterior) | ₤ 200 - ₤ 1,500 |
Permitting & & inspections | ₤ 50 - ₤ 300 |
Total | ₤ 1,000 - ₤ 5,000+ |

Is it needed to acquire an authorization for bay window installation?
Licenses are typically required for structural changes. It is advisable to examine local guidelines and speak with your professional about whether any licenses are needed.
Can I install a bay window myself?
While it is technically possible to install a bay window as a DIY project, it is recommended to work with specialists due to the intricacy included, especially if structural alterations are needed.
For how long does it usually require to install a bay window?
Installation typically takes one to three days, depending on the complexity of the job, however multiple factors can affect this timeline.
